Nathaniel Mendez-Laing: It's Happy Days

11 April 2016

Nathaniel Mendez-Laing spoke to Dale PlayerHD after the weekend’s 2-1 win over Peterborough United…


He netted Rochdale’s second of the afternoon against his former side.

“It’s always a good feeling to score, Peterborough or not. I always want to score when I go out there. We wanted the three points today and we’ve come away with them so it’s happy days.

“I thought we started very well and were on the front foot. We didn’t put away all our chances but it was pleasing to go in at half-time leading. The Gaffer said to us at half-time to go out and do it again. I think they changed their formation which was hard for us to work out but we stuck in there and got the three points.

“Because we didn’t get the win against Doncaster, which we had hoped for, we badly wanted the three points." 

With five games left to play, the play-off dream is still alive for Rochdale with the side still in with a small shout of securing a top six finish.

Mendez-Laing says the players aren't looking too far ahead. 

“We’re just taking it one game at a time. If we can win all our games and the teams above us drop points, then that’s great, but we’re just focusing on finishing with as many points as possible. No matter what happens, I personally think we’ve done well this season.”
